  • BROADWAY BANK

    Sigma helps Broadway Bank earn faster, easy-to-manage data backups with EMC Avamar

    Broadway Bank, a multi-billion dollar financial services organization, has prospered even as the economy and banking industry have struggled. With the tagline, “We’re here for good,” the San Antonio, Texas-based bank has successfully grown its customer base and array of financial products.

    “Our business expansion has caused our IT infrastructure to grow rapidly,” says Bill Meek, Senior Vice President and Information Systems Manager. “In only three years, our server population has grown over 300 percent and we have virtualized approximately 60 percent of our server infrastructure with VMware.”

    As data accumulated rapidly, the bank’s reliance on four different tape backup solutions was making it more difficult to ensure comprehensive data protection.

    “One of our biggest challenges was managing many different backup environments,” says Meek. “Because daily incremental backups could take eight hours or longer, we’d have to overlap our backups or we’d run into business hours… It was difficult to manage, and we were having trouble keeping up with our backups as our data kept growing.”

     

    Solutions

    After evaluating available options, Broadway Bank consolidated its tape-based solutions, including Symantec Backup EXEC software on EMC Avamar backup and recovery software, with integrated global data deduplication, to solve their current and anticipated backup requirements. The bank uses Avamar to perform fast, daily, full agent based backups for physical and VMware virtualized servers across their 38 branch offices, a primary data center and a secondary data center. All data is backed up to Avamar Data Store systems at the primary data center, which are replicated to the bank’s disaster recovery site for additional protection.

    Unlike traditional backup methods, Avamar deduplicates backup data at the source so that only new, unique sub-file data segments are transferred during daily dull backups and stored to disk. Avamar also deduplicates data globally, across virtual and physical environments to reduce the required backed disk storage by up to 50 times.

    Applications protected by Avamar include check imaging, teller management, loan processing, data warehousing, as well as Microsoft SQL databases, Exchange e-mail, Dynamics CRM and SharePoint. Application data and VMware virtual machines are stored on an EMC CLARiiON CX3 storage area network (SAN), which included a gateway to EMC Celerra network-attached storage (NAS). Broadway Bank also uses an Avamar NDMP Accelerator node to back up Celerra, which store documents, spreadsheets, presentations and other files for the bank’s approximately 650 employees. In total, Avamar protects 10 terabytes of data for Broadway Bank.

    Keeping Pace with Business Growth

    With increased IT flexibility and reliability provided by Avamar and VMware server virtualization, Broadway Bank has kept pace with business growth, while focusing on customer satisfaction and product quality.

    ‘When we used to use tape backup systems, our daily incremental backups and weekly full backups would take many hours to complete,” says Meek. “With Avamar, we get daily full backups in less than an hour across our existing network links with 99.7 percent daily data reduction. Restore quality and speed also improved.”

    Avamar was especially successful within Broadway Bank’s growing VMware environment.

    “VMware has been essential in keeping up with our business growth,” says Mr. Meek. “We have approximately 60 percent of our servers virtualized now, but when we rolled it out, we knew our previous backup solution wasn’t going to keep up. We brought Avamar in because of its integration with VMware, and the backup and restore performance has been outstanding.”

    “We have a single, centrally managed solution for backing everything in our physical and virtual environments – from small branch servers, to file shares, to large databases and replicating it all to another site,” says Bill Rigsby, Vice President and Senior Systems Engineer. “Avamar is a very versatile, comprehensive solution.”

     

    Streamlined Backup Management

    “The solution also addressed our need for superior data security,” says Meek. “Our data is much more secure. We no longer have to worry about tapes getting misplaced. Our management and auditors love that we’ve moved in this direction.”

    The bank is spending significantly less time managing backups since Avamar was deployed.

    “Avamar is a set it and forget it solution,” says Rigsby. “We used to spend 20 to 30 hours weekly babysitting backup jobs, replacing tapes, restarting failed jobs and so on. Now, it is five minutes a day. We’re also now tapeless, so our tape expense has gone away. The overall savings have been huge.”

  • CITY OF MISSOURI CITY, TEXAS

    Sigma helps the City of Missouri City utilize virtualization for server consolidation, disaster recovery and a more flexible infrastructure.

    The City of Missouri City, Texas, works hard to provide high-quality services while keeping costs low. Information technology plays a key role in these efforts. The city relies upon its IT infrastructure to support its operations and deliver information and electronic services to nearly 70,000 residents. Yet over time the city’s data centers had become filled with aging and underutilized servers that demanded time-consuming administration and management.

    The “Show Me City” understood that virtualization could help trim this overhead, but needed a partner to help plan and deploy a new virtualized infrastructure. After completing an RFP process, the city selected Sigma Solutions based upon its significant experience delivering robust data center solutions.

    “We were looking to move to a more virtual environment with VMware in order to eliminate some of our physical servers,” said Lathaniel Allen, IT Operations Manager, City of Missouri City. “We were also looking for a more robust SAN solution that would support our foreseeable storage needs.     Sigma helped the city utilize VMware ESX to reduce 40 or 50 physical servers down to three servers running virtual machines. Sigma also implemented an EMC SAN and the VMware View desktop virtualization solution.

    Seeing Real Value

    For its next project, the city asked Sigma to assist with a failover site for disaster recovery. Faced with a variety of natural threats — tornadoes, wildfires, hurricanes and even the occasional snowstorm — the city needed to ensure that its systems and data were protected.

    “We wanted to set up a second site that replicated our primary site for redundancy,” Allen said. “We bought some additional VMware licenses and Site Recovery Manager for automated failover. We also bought a second EMC SAN for data replication. The same Sigma engineer came out and installed everything in our second data center in City Hall. It went very smoothly.”

    Allen says virtualization has exceeded the city’s expectations.

    “It has cut down on power and cooling and our physical footprint. My system administrator doesn’t have as many servers to maintain, and we don’t have to worry about replacing hardware should one of those older machines fail,” he said.

    “Desktop virtualization is also going well. We didn’t have much information on that, and were concerned because we have areas with different types of systems. Sigma ran with it and laid the groundwork for us to implement 30 virtual desktops during the first phase. They showed my system administrator how to set everything up and suggested some thin clients.
